Transaction 74dd1017b12ac488902e66b1926fc0090a7227071fb1d789ac2c537585a51226

1 Input
2 Outputs
  • 74dd1017b12ac488902e66b1926fc0090a7227071fb1d789ac2c537585a51226:0
  • value  87000000
    address  16VvrGgLBi56FoT4e4CiiEVniBsxFY4UVu
  • 74dd1017b12ac488902e66b1926fc0090a7227071fb1d789ac2c537585a51226:1
  • value  2015221547
    address  16xx69DM5kGiBCrqeG7Bx9RVebpcik2fLu